Avatar m tn There are advantages and disadvantages to, both, desiccated (so-called "natural" hormones) and synthetic hormones. Synthetic hormones are supposedly identical to the ones your body would make if it could, while the desiccated hormones, such as Armour, NatureThroid, ERFA, etc come from pig thyroid. Pigs produce much more T3 (which is about 4 times more powerful than T4), than humans do and many of us don't need that much T3, though some do.

Avatar m tn I had a read through and found there are no UK manufacturers of desiccated thyroid hormone or synthetic T4/T3 combinations. Therefore, the only way you can switch to natural desiccated thyroid hormone or the synthetic T4/T3 combinations is through "Named Patient Basis". This means in certain circumstances your doctor can prescribe a medication because you have a special need for a certain medication.
